Question

Which of the following security appliances would be used to only analyze traffic and send alerts when predefined patterns of unauthorized traffic are detected on the network?

Options

  • AHost based IPS
  • BNetwork based firewall
  • CSignature based IDS
  • DBehavior based IPS

Explanation

An IDS (Intrusion Detection System) is a passive monitoring device - it analyzes traffic and generates alerts but does NOT actively block traffic. A signature-based IDS specifically compares traffic against a database of known attack patterns (signatures) to identify threats. An IPS (Intrusion Prevention System) actively blocks detected threats, which eliminates the host-based IPS and behavior-based IPS options. A network-based firewall enforces access control rules but doesn't focus on signature pattern detection and alerting. The key distinguishing words in the question are 'only analyze' and 'send alerts,' which point exclusively to IDS.
